Fixing a Freezing Signal: A Step-by-Step Guide
To fix a signal that keeps freezing, you need to identify and address the root cause of the problem. Here’s a direct answer: **check your internet connection, update your device or software, and reset your device to its default settings**.
Step-by-Step Guide
1. **Check your internet connection**: Ensure your internet is working properly by checking other devices connected to the same network. Restart your router if necessary.
2. **Update your device or software**: Check for updates on your device or software and install the latest version. This can often resolve compatibility issues.
3. **Reset your device to its default settings**: This will restore your device to its original settings, which can help resolve software-related issues.
4. **Check for physical obstructions**: Move any physical obstacles that might be blocking the signal, such as walls or furniture.
5. **Check your device’s antenna or signal booster**: Ensure the antenna is properly connected or consider using a signal booster to improve your signal strength.
